MINUTE ORDER (Text Entry Only) On December 10, 2025, Petitioner, through a next friend, filed a petition for a writ of habeas corpus p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 2241 in the United States District Court for the Central District of California. (Doc. 1 .) On January 5, 2026, the matter was ordered transferred to this Court. (Doc. 4 .) However, the matter was not opened in this Court until February 17, 2026. (Doc. 6 .) On February 19, 2026, the assigned magistrate set a merits briefing schedule, providing a 45 day response deadline, followed by a 45 day period for Petitioner to file a traverse. (Doc. 10 .) On February 25, 2026, Counsel entered an appearance for Petitioner (Doc. 14 ) and amended the Petition (Doc. 15 ), which was amended again the next day (Doc. 18 ). Counsel also filed a motion to shorten time, which appears to request immediate release by way of a temporary restraining order or at least expedited consideration of the merits. (Doc. 16 .) To the extent Petitioner is requesting a TRO, the Court notes that she has been detained since October 15, 2025. (Doc. 1 at 2.) Despite having been detained for at least four months (and at least two months at the time of the filing of the Petition), Petitioner fails to explain adequately the delay in seeking a temporary restraining order or why, despite this delay, the Court should nonetheless treat the situation as an emergency that must be handled on shortened time. Thus, the TRO request is untimely, and it is DENIED. SeeLocal Rule 231(b). However, given the delay caused by the transfer to this District and the fact that recent filings in apparently similar cases suggest that Respondents do not require 45 days to respond to Petitions of this nature, the Court will accelerate the briefing schedule on the merits. Thus, the Court adjusts the briefing schedule as follows: Respondents SHALL file their responsive pleading on or before March 17, 2026. Petitioner may file a traverse no later than 10 days after Respondents file their brief but may attempt to accelerate disposition of the matter by filing any traverse early signed by District Judge Jennifer L. Thurston on February 27, 2026. (Deputy Clerk IM) (Entered: 02/27/2026)
